软件是怎么开发出来的,怎样才可以做软件
软件是由程序员使用编程语言和开发工具开发出来的。软件是一种逻辑产品,是程序、数据和文档的**,需要经过需求分析、设计、编码、测试、维护等阶段才能完成。软件开发工具包括编程语言(如Java、C++、Python等)、集成开发环境(IDE)、软件测试工具等,程序员使用这些工具编写、调试和测试程序,实现软件的功能和性能要求。
软件开发方面:抖音软件的制作涉及了复杂的软件开发流程,包括需求分析、设计、编码、测试等多个阶段。每个阶段都需要专业的技术人员进行精细化的工作,以确保软件的稳定性和功能性。算法设计:抖音的成功在很大程度上得益于其强大的算法设计。
软件开发阶段软件设计:分为概要设计和详细设计两个部分 软件实现:把软件设计转换成计算机可以接受的程序代码软件测试:在设计测试用例的基础上检验软件的各个组成部分 软件运行维护阶段 软件投入运行,并在使用中不断地维护,进行必要的扩充和删改。
开发一款软件,从拥有现成的代码到最终的成品,这之间需要经历一系列的步骤。其中,关键的一步是利用开发工具将代码转换成可执行的程序。例如,使用Visual Studio等集成开发环境(IDE),开发者可以编写、调试和编译代码。编译的过程就是将人类可读的代码转换成计算机能够直接执行的机器语言。
建立游戏idea初始:从某种角度而言,手机游戏APP制作就是一种回归传统,也是新旧技术的融合。想要开发一款手机APP游戏,首先要做的就是关于游戏APP的idea,然后再开始进行APP开发工作,在APP设计工具的选择上和网页设计的工具差不多。
智能手机应用软件如何开发
手机APP开发可以通过下面三种方式:原生APP(Native App)原生APP是用原生程式编写运行的一种第三方应用程序,它是基于移动设备(智能手机、平板电脑等)操作系统(如IOS、Andriod、WP)使用,用户通过应用市场或应用商店进行下载安装到自己的智能设备上。
从开发的角度上简单的说手机软件可以分成应用软件、用户界面、操作系统、底层与设备驱动以及通信协议等几个方面。测试是手机软件开发的另外一个重要领域,分为协议测试、白箱测试以及系统测试。
营销推广手机APP软件 专注在一些关键领域有效的推广你的APP软件,让你的客户能够发现它,并且下载它。APP应用软件的一些基本要素将会成为营销机会,那也是获得成功的关键。你的工作,就是要为用户从发现APP应用图标到点击下载按键,创造出一条无缝业务流。
整理手机app软件开发需求;把app软件开发需求整理成文档,提交给app开发团队,如【酷蜂科技】;功能需求确定,然后开始app软件的原型策划以及UI界面策划;原型图及UI界面策划完毕,开始程序开发;程序开发完成,测试;测试完成,然后提交。
APP制作成本包含参与人员的工资 通常情况下,开发一款APP需要产品经理、客户端工程师、后端工程师和UI设计师各一名,这已经是制作手机APP应用软件比较精简的配置了,所以这些参与人员的工资也是包含在APP制作成本当中的。这些工作人员的月薪加起来可能都会超过5万元。
谷歌推出的AppInventorAndroidApp开发工具可以让你仅通过拖拉式的简单操作就可以创建自己的AndroidApp。对于那些为了特定目的想要动手尝试开发一个简单应用的用户。
智能体开发
企业级智能体开发服务。咨询电话:400-821-7070!知识问答、AI客服、流程自动化、AI数据分析等近百个场景智能体。
智能体开发的核心在于理解其功能定位、平台分类及实际应用场景,通过技术工具与工作流整合实现自动化与效率提升。
年腾讯云智能体开发平台入门指南 腾讯云推出的智能体开发平台以多Agent协同、RAG(检索增强生成)与Workflow框架为核心,集成文档解析、知识库管理等工具,支持通过MCP协议连接外部系统,实现AI从“对话”到“行动”的跨越。以下从平台功能、开发流程、应用场景三个维度展开介绍。
自主智能系统的研究包括什么的开发?
1、自主智能系统的研究包括基于仿真的智能系统开发、智能自主系统软件的设计与开发以及人工智能相关领域的开发。
2、模式识别与智能系统的研究方向主要包括:机器学习:作为人工智能的核心技术,通过训练数据使计算机具有自主学习能力。深度学习:机器学习的延伸,通过神经网络模拟人脑的学习过程。计算机视觉:研究图像和视频的处理与识别,是实际应用中的热点。
3、研究方向 模式识别与智能系统的研究方向主要包括机器学习、深度学习、计算机视觉、语音识别与自然语言处理、生物识别技术等。这些方向涵盖了从数据采集、处理到模式分类、识别以及智能决策等多个环节的研究。其中,机器学习是核心基础,深度学习是其重要分支,而计算机视觉和语音识别则是应用广泛的领域。
4、智能系统与机器人:聚焦自主无人系统与智能装备开发,研究方向包括机器人动力学控制、群体智能协同算法等。学院团队研制的应急救援机器人曾应用于地震灾后搜救,其多传感器融合导航系统可适应复杂地形;开发基于ROS的智能采摘机器人,通过3D视觉定位实现果蔬精准采收。
5、研究人工智能在教育领域的应用,包括个性化学习、智能辅导、课程推荐以及学习分析等。 智能机器人 开发能够执行复杂任务的自主机器人,涉及机器视觉、自然语言处理、决策树以及人工智能算法等。 智能安防 研究如何使用人工智能进行安全监控,包括面部识别、行为分析、异常检测以及紧急响应系统等。
智能软件研究方向
1、智能软件的研究方向涵盖多个领域,主要包括软件智能化运维、基于无源感知的智能系统、知识驱动的认知计算、面向智能体软件工程、智能基础理论与系统、智能软件工程、智能软件理论与应用以及数据挖掘与智能计算。软件智能化运维:该方向聚焦于基于多智能体和群体智能技术的智能软件系统开发。
2、智能软件研究方向:结合人工智能技术,开发具有智能特性的软件系统,如智能决策支持系统、智能机器人软件、自然语言处理软件等,使软件能够模拟人类的智能行为。对应课程:人工智能、人机界面。
3、支撑技术方向聚焦于人工智能的底层架构与工具开发,如人工智能架构与系统设计、开发工具链、通用框架(如TensorFlow、PyTorch)及专用智能芯片(如GPU、TPU),为算法实现提供硬件与软件支持。
4、“人工智能”属于计算机学科研究方向中的计算机应用方向。计算机学科的研究方向通常涵盖理论、系统、软件、应用等多个层面。其中,计算机应用方向聚焦于将计算机技术转化为解决实际问题的工具,强调技术在实际场景中的落地与效能。
